Lis

A Law Dictionary and Glossary · George C. Kinney · 1893

A Law Dictionary and Glossary

I. A controversy or dispute; a suit at law. Lis alibi pendens: an action pending elsewhere; a plea of such an action. Lis mota: a controversy originated; a term frequently used in the discussion of evidence in matters of pedigree, and held to import not an actual suit commenced, but a dispute or controversy originating prior to the beginning of judicial proceedings. Lis pendens: a pending suit; the actual pendency of a suit, or other judicial proceeding; in a suit regarding land, such legal process as gives notice to all the ■world of a dispute as to the title; in equity, except by statute requiring record, the filing of a bill and service of a subpoena. In the civil law. Lis pendens: a suit pending.
